Heim  >  Artikel  >  Backend-Entwicklung  >  Wie man PHP zur Umsetzung von Projekten in der Bildungsbranche nutzt

Wie man PHP zur Umsetzung von Projekten in der Bildungsbranche nutzt

PHPz
PHPzOriginal
2023-06-23 09:57:12672Durchsuche

Mit der Entwicklung des Internets hat die Bildungsbranche allmählich begonnen, sich in Richtung Digitalisierung und Intelligenz zu wandeln. Viele Bildungseinrichtungen haben damit begonnen, ihre eigenen Online-Bildungsplattformen aufzubauen, in der Hoffnung, den Bedürfnissen von Schülern und Eltern gerecht zu werden und bequemere Bildungsdienste anzubieten. In diesem Prozess ist die PHP-Sprache zu einer beliebten Wahl für die Projektentwicklung in der Bildungsbranche geworden.

PHP ist eine serverseitige Open-Source-Skriptsprache, die leicht zu erlernen und zu verwenden ist und sich schnell entwickeln lässt. In Projekten der Bildungsbranche kann die Verwendung der PHP-Sprache für die Entwicklung viele Vorteile bringen, wie zum Beispiel:

1 Schnelle Entwicklung: Die PHP-Sprache hat eine einfache Syntax, ist leicht zu erlernen und sehr effizient beim Schreiben von Code, wodurch sie für eine schnelle Entwicklung geeignet ist verschiedener Anwendungen.

2. Sicherheit: Die PHP-Sprache verfügt über viele Sicherheitsmechanismen, die die Sicherheit von Benutzerinformationen wirksam schützen können.

3. Zuverlässigkeit: Der Code der PHP-Sprache wurde gründlich getestet und verbessert, und die Qualität ist garantiert, was die Zuverlässigkeit des Projekts unterstützt.

Wenn Sie also die PHP-Sprache zur Implementierung von Projekten in der Bildungsbranche verwenden möchten, wie sollten Sie das tun?

Schritt eins: Anforderungen ermitteln

Vor jeder Projektentwicklung sollten zunächst die Anforderungen des Projekts bestätigt werden. Bei der Entwicklung von Projekten in der Bildungsbranche umfassen die Anforderungen im Allgemeinen die folgenden Aspekte:

1. Benutzerverwaltung: einschließlich Benutzerregistrierung, Anmeldung, Passwortabruf und anderer Funktionen.

2. Kursverwaltung: einschließlich Kursveröffentlichung, -verwaltung, -kauf und anderen Funktionen.

3. Live-Unterricht: einschließlich Online-Unterricht, Fragen und Antworten, Kommunikation und anderen Funktionen.

4. Lernbericht: einschließlich Lernfortschritt des Benutzers, akademischer Leistung, Testergebnisse und anderen Funktionen.

5. Zahlungsfunktion: einschließlich Online-Zahlung, Rückerstattung und anderen Funktionen.

6. Datenverwaltung: einschließlich Datenanalyse, Datenstatistik und anderen Funktionen.

Je nach tatsächlicher Situation können die oben genannten Anforderungen entsprechend erhöht, verringert und angepasst werden.

Schritt 2: Wählen Sie ein Framework

Nachdem Sie Ihre Anforderungen ermittelt haben, können Sie mit der Auswahl eines PHP-Frameworks für die Entwicklung beginnen. Das PHP-Framework ist eine Softwareentwicklungsumgebung, die schnelle Entwicklung, einfache Wartung und Skalierbarkeit bietet. Bei der Auswahl eines Frameworks sollten Sie folgende Faktoren berücksichtigen:

1. Anwendungsbereich: Ob das Framework für die Entwicklung von Projekten in der Bildungsbranche geeignet ist und ob es den Anforderungen gerecht werden kann.

2. Benutzerfreundlichkeit: Ist das Framework einfach zu verwenden und zu erlernen und verfügt es über ausreichende Dokumentation und Tutorials?

3. Erweiterbarkeit: ob das Framework Plug-Ins und Erweiterungen unterstützt und ob es für die Sekundärentwicklung einfach ist.

Zu den häufig verwendeten PHP-Frameworks auf dem Markt gehören Laravel, Yii, Symfony, Zend usw. Sie können je nach tatsächlicher Situation ein Framework auswählen, das für die Entwicklung zu Ihnen passt.

Schritt 3: Entwerfen Sie die Datenbank

Nachdem Sie das Framework festgelegt haben, können Sie mit dem Entwurf der Datenbank beginnen. Beim Entwurf einer Datenbank sollten folgende Faktoren berücksichtigt werden:

1. Datenstruktur: Welche Datentabellen sollten in die Datenbank aufgenommen werden und welche Beziehungen bestehen zwischen den Datentabellen?

2. Felddesign: Welche Felder sollten in jede Datentabelle aufgenommen werden und wie sollten Feldtypen, Längen und andere Elemente festgelegt werden.

3. Datenoperation: Wie man Daten hinzufügt, löscht, ändert und überprüft und welche Methode zum Herstellen einer Verbindung zur Datenbank verwendet werden sollte.

4. Sicherheit: So gewährleisten Sie die Sicherheit von Daten und verhindern Sicherheitsprobleme wie SQL-Injection.

Der Entwurf einer angemessenen Datenbankstruktur kann nicht nur die Effizienz und Leistung des gesamten Systems verbessern, sondern auch die Stabilität des Systems erhöhen.

Schritt 4: Code schreiben

Nach Abschluss der oben genannten Schritte können Sie mit dem Schreiben von PHP-Code beginnen. Beim Schreiben von Code sollten Sie die folgenden Grundsätze befolgen:

1. Einfachheit: Der Code sollte prägnant und leicht verständlich sein und es sollte keinen redundanten Code enthalten.

2. Standards: Der Code sollte bestimmten Standards folgen, um die Wartung und Erweiterung zu erleichtern.

3. Erweiterbar: Der Code sollte leicht zu erweitern und sekundär zu entwickeln sein, um spätere System-Upgrades und Wartung zu erleichtern.

4. Sicherheit: Der Code sollte die Sicherheit berücksichtigen, um häufige Angriffe zu verhindern.

Beim Schreiben von Code sollte je nach Bedarf ein modulares und mehrschichtiges Design durchgeführt werden, um Entwicklung, Upgrade und Wartung zu erleichtern.

Schritt 5: Testen und online gehen

Nachdem das Schreiben abgeschlossen ist, muss es noch getestet und online gehen. Während der Testphase sollte das System umfassend getestet werden, einschließlich Funktionstests, Leistungstests, Sicherheitstests usw., um die Stabilität und Sicherheit des Systems sicherzustellen. Bevor Sie online gehen, müssen Sie auf die folgenden Punkte achten:

1. Serverumgebung: Der Server sollte über ausreichende Leistung und Skalierbarkeit verfügen, um die Anwendungsanforderungen des Systems zu erfüllen.

2. Domainname und Hinterlegung: Für das System sollte ein passender Domainname ausgewählt und hinterlegt werden.

3. Sicherheit: Eine Reihe von Sicherheitsmaßnahmen sollten ergriffen werden, um die Sicherheit der Benutzerinformationen zu gewährleisten.

Zusammenfassung

Die Verwendung von PHP zur Implementierung von Projekten in der Bildungsbranche erfordert eine Vielzahl von Fähigkeiten und Kenntnissen, darunter Programmierkenntnisse, Kenntnisse im Datenbankdesign, Kenntnisse im Servermanagement usw. Erst nach der Beherrschung der erforderlichen Fähigkeiten und Kenntnisse kann die Entwicklung von Projekten in der Bildungsbranche besser umgesetzt werden. Ich hoffe, dass dieser Artikel für alle hilfreich ist und dass jeder die PHP-Sprache in der tatsächlichen Projektentwicklung besser nutzen und mehr Beiträge zur digitalen Transformation der Bildungsbranche leisten kann.

Das obige ist der detaillierte Inhalt vonWie man PHP zur Umsetzung von Projekten in der Bildungsbranche nutzt.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n